High-Ticket Models You Can Use

Each model has its perks and style.

Model #1: The Direct Sale Model

You send people straight to a high-ticket offer.

It works best for products that don’t need much explaining.

You connect someone with a need to the perfect solution.

High-Ticket Webinar Model

You invite people to watch a video about the product.

Your job is to invite people who need the solution.

Webinar models work well for complex or expensive items.

Phone Call High-Ticket Model

Some high-ticket products need a personal touch.

It’s perfect for sales over $2,000—like coaching or business solutions.

All you do is help people see the value, then let the pros close the sale.

Model #4: The Application Model

The company checks if they’re a good fit.

You get paid if they move forward.

People like to feel chosen.

Model #5: The Hybrid Model

For example, they start with a webinar, then offer a phone call, then close with an application.

It’s all about making the path easy and clear.
